Workingmen`s Houses, James Rooney House, 354 Southern Ave Dubuque, Dubuque County, IA
Similar in scale, configuration and materials to the other workingmen`s houses built along Southern Avenue in the 1870s and 1880s, the James Rooney House is visually distinguished by its atypically deep setback from the street. It is further distinguished by its excellent state of preservation. Historically, the house is typically associated with Dubuque`s early proletariat.
